Welcome to the World of Lee Style T’ai Chi Chuan
(“The Supreme Ultimate”)

If you suffer from tension and stress, you will find that, with practice, you will learn to relax, able to do so whenever you wish.

If you are shy and timid you will find that in time your posture and breathing will improve, making you in turn feel more balanced, confident and in control of yourself.

If you suffer from anger and frustration you will soon remember again the natural beauty and rhythm in life, which cannot be forced, but lived with in harmony.

If you suffer from ill health, you will find that the practice of T’ai Chi will help improve your general health and well-being, increase your energy, tone your muscles, stretch your body, improve your posture and balance, improve your immune system and circulation, improve your strength and flexibility...we could go on and on.

And if you are perfectly healthy and happy, you will find that T’ai Chi is a beautiful, life-affirming
thing to do.
Enjoy . . .
